Universal’s latest thriller, the M. Night Shyamalan directed ‘Knock at the Cabin’ made it’s arrival in theaters over the weekend globally, and is now celebrating their phenomenal success from Thursday night to Sunday night which saw the film open to the #1 spot on the charts in the United States.
The film opened to $21,222,000 over the weekend around the world.
According to the synopsis: ““While vacationing at a remote cabin, a young girl and her parents are taken hostage by four armed strangers who demand that the family make an unthinkable choice to avert the apocalypse. With limited access to the outside world, the family must decide what they believe before all is lost.”
Dave Bautista (Army of the Dead), Rupert Grint (“Servant”) and Nikki Amuka-Bird (Old) star alongside Ben Aldridge (“Pennyworth”) and Jonathan Groff (“Mindhunter”)
M. Night Shyamalan is slated to do another film with Universal, and while the film does not yet have a title, it is expected to arrive in theaters on April 5th, 2024.
